Message archiving enables audit trail tracking in the event of an incident, such as data leakage, guarantees message legitimacy by uniformly controlling all corporate messages, and has mainly been introduced across North America. From the perspective of supply chain risk management, meeting North American standards for email compliance is now assumed to be a default requirement for Japanese companies when trading with overseas companies subject to North American legislation. Recently within Japan, the introduction of email and instant message archiving has been promoted in line with increased awareness of compliance and internal controls such as Japan's newly enacted version of the US Sarbanes-Oxley legislation (J-SOX), which came into effect on April 1, 2008. Global Relay's Message Archiver, in addition to compliance mandates under SEC, FINRA and FRCP in North America, meets J-SOX requirements for Japanese businesses in order to manage and preserve business email and documents using long term storage and quick retrieval, as well as to control and supervise employee access to and disclosure of information.

Message Archiver service details
- Secure tamper-protected storage of all internal and external emails for up to seven years.
Copies of all messages delivered internally and externally are kept in storage with a redundant configuration, as well as being sent to two physically separated data centers (certified to SAS 70 Type II standards). The message data is encrypted twice with AES and RSA encryption and saved on WORM (Write Once Read Many) storage to prevent tampering.
- Messages and their attachments can quickly and easily be searched via the web using a dedicated management tool designed to also support audit and electronic discovery requirements
Message Archiver provides a dedicated tool with a real-time monitoring and auditing function with support for electronic legal discovery (eDiscovery). For example, searches can be defined by senders, receivers (including bcc), titles, text, dates, and attachments in archived emails. With search indexing for Japanese and Asian character sets, data for all archived messages can be searched within seconds via a simple web-based operation on a unique search engine.
